Also attached is the minutes and a sketch that was included in the item. Many new owners probably aren't aware of all the benefits they receive from buying a strucuture in a historic district. And, these benefits can be significant points. For example, new owners should know that the appearance and character of your neighborhood is protected by local ordinance. Any exterior changes to the structure need to be approved by the committee before work starts. Because neighborhoods in historic districts are stable, refined and protected, real estate there tends to maintain and increase its value slightly better than property in non -historic districts. As a result, new owners won't have to worry about the value of their property declining in the future due to incompatible architectural features. There are many benefits to home ownership in a historic district. There are also tax benefits to ownership in a National Register Historic District. You may be eligible for a state income tax credit (Act 498 of 2009). There's a lot of good information in the Guidelines, so you might want to pick up a copy.
